Singapore independent Jadestone Energy plans to develop two shallow-water gas fields in Vietnam with wellhead platforms tied into an existing offshore pipeline.

The Nam Du and U Minh gas fields are located in Block 46/07 and Block 51, respectively, off south-west Vietnam. The two fields are 23 kilometres apart and lie immediately north of the Repsol-operated PM3 project area.

Jadestone is aiming to connect its gas from the Nam Du and U Minh gas fields to the PM3-to-Ca Mau gas export pipeline to southern Vietnam.
